The dynamic and structural behaviour of monomer in supercooled polymer system: a molecular dynamics study

Resumen:
The relaxation in a simple bead-spring polymer system in the supercooled regime near its glass transition temperature was investigated with Molecular Dynamics simulations. The relationship between the structural and dynamic behaviour experienced by the glass former when it approaches the glass transition temperature (Tg), is key to understanding the formation of glasses.1 In this work, we introduce a new approach to look at the dynamic lengthscales that emerge in linear polymer, focusing on the tendency of the monomers to be dynamical correlated, through a Isoconfigurational Ensamble (ICE) Method.
